The global construction engineering sector is currently undergoing a massive transformation. Infrastructure projects such as high-speed railways, underground metros, highway tunnels, and hydroelectric dams require extensive rock drilling and excavation. While hydraulic and electric drilling rigs have gained popularity in large-scale open-pit operations, pneumatic rock drills like the YT27 remain irreplaceable in underground construction, steep slope stabilization, and medium-to-hard rock tunneling. The primary commercial driver for this preference is the unmatched power-to-weight ratio of pneumatic systems, coupled with lower initial capital investment and simplified on-site maintenance.
Moreover, in rugged terrains and confined spaces where heavy machinery cannot gain access, human-portable air-leg pneumatic drills offer the flexibility required to execute precise blasting holes and anchoring bolt holes. The reliability of compressed air systems ensures continuous operation even under extreme temperature fluctuations and wet, dusty conditions typical of underground construction engineering projects.
The YT27 air-leg pneumatic rock drill is characterized by its high efficiency, strong flushing capabilities, and rapid drilling speeds. It is designed to drill horizontal, inclined, and vertical blast holes in medium-hard to hard rock (f=8-18). Here are the core engineering advantages that define this equipment:
The internal valve mechanism of the YT27 is engineered to maximize the energy output from compressed air. By delivering rapid, high-energy impacts to the drill bit, it shears rock formations with minimal energy loss, translating directly into faster penetration rates and reduced fuel consumption of the powering air compressor.
Dust control is critical in construction engineering, both for environmental compliance and operator health. The YT27 features a robust water-flushing mechanism that suppresses silica dust at the source while simultaneously cooling the drill bit, significantly extending the service life of consumable chisels and moil points.
The versatility of the YT27 Pneumatic Rock Drill allows it to be deployed across a wide spectrum of civil engineering and geological projects:
In railway and highway tunnel construction, workers utilize the YT27 mounted on pusher air-legs to drill horizontal blasting holes. The adjustable air-leg provides the necessary forward thrust, reducing physical strain on the operator. This setup allows for rapid "drill-and-blast" cycles, which is the foundational method for tunneling through hard granite and basalt formations.
For highway cuts and mountainous construction zones, preventing landslides is paramount. Engineers use the YT27 to drill deep anchoring holes into rock faces. Steel rebars or rock bolts are then inserted and grouted to stabilize the slope. The lightweight design of the YT27 makes it possible to operate on scaffolding suspended high above the ground.
Before concrete foundations can be poured for massive structures like bridges or skyscrapers, the underlying bedrock must be excavated. The YT27 is used to block-split and drill dynamic blasting holes, ensuring precise rock removal without damaging surrounding geological structures.
Looking forward, the development of pneumatic rock drills is heavily focused on reducing vibration transmission to operators and minimizing noise levels. Modern iterations of the YT27 incorporate advanced silencing mufflers and vibration-dampening handles. Furthermore, the integration of smart air compressors, like the Luy120-14, allows for real-time pressure regulation. This ensures that the rock drill receives a steady supply of air at the optimal pressure, reducing wear and tear and lowering carbon emissions on construction sites.

CE certification is a mandatory conformity mark for certain products sold within the European Economic Area (EEA). CE stands for "Conformité Européenne" which translates to "European Conformity." The CE mark certifies that a product has met EU consumer safety, health or environmental requirements. CE certification also allows manufacturers to freely circulate their products within the EEA.
ISO 9001:2015 is an international quality management system (QMS) standard that outlines requirements for a quality management system. The standard is designed to help organizations ensure they meet customer and regulatory requirements.
